The Government of the Federated States of Micronesia (FSM), with support from the World Bank, is implementing the Strengthening Public Financial Management II (PFM II) Project (P181237) and intends to apply part of the project proceeds toward the engagement of an Individual Consultant to support the National Government’s Budget Division.
The consulting services (“the Services”) involve providing specialized technical assistance to strengthen FSM’s budget formulation, budget execution monitoring, forecasting, reporting, and the integration of budget processes into the new FMIS. The Advisor will support multi-year budget reforms, improvements to budget classification and documentation, strengthening of internal procedures, and development of sustainable capacity within the Budget Division.
The Consultant will also contribute to the review of budget-related legislation and regulations, enhance medium-term budgeting approaches, improve forecasting methodologies, and support the phased introduction of program budgeting in accordance with the Project Appraisal Document (PAD) and Financing Agreement. In addition, the Advisor will work closely with the FMIS team to align the Chart of Accounts and budget structures with system configuration and reporting requirements.

BACKGROUND
The Federated States of Micronesia (FSM), through the Department of Finance & Administration (DoFA), is implementing the Strengthening Public Financial Management II (PFM II) Project with financing support from the World Bank (IDA Grant). The objective of PFM II is to improve fiscal management practices and increase fiscal transparency at the National Government level.
Under Component 1 – Improved Fiscal Management Practices and Controls, the Project provides technical assistance to strengthen budgeting, financial reporting, internal procedures, and fiscal oversight. This Terms of Reference (TOR) outlines the responsibilities and deliverables of a Technical Advisor to support the Budget Division in implementing multi-year budget reforms envisioned in the PAD and Financing Agreement.
This engagement is financed under PFM II and procured as an Individual Consultant (INDV) assignment through Direct Selection if need be or on Open International competition, subject to Prior Review by the World Bank. The assignment is strictly technical assistance and capacity-building in nature and does not involve performing DOFA’s routine operational budgeting functions.
PURPOSE AND OBJECTIVES
The objective of this assignment is to support DoFA to strengthen budget formulation, execution monitoring, reporting, forecasting, and integration with the FMIS; strengthen budget quality through improvements in budget classification and documentation; support the review of budget legislation, policies and procedures; and build sustainable capacity within the Budget Division to independently manage and improve FSM’s national budget process.
